Chapter 2: System hardware overview
Number Component Description
- Lid
Connected physically to the base by a hinge, and electrically
with RF jumper cables, AC power cable and DC power and
control cables.
Possible components:
• Lid motherboard
• Pebble-2 module
• Jetty-1 remote switch
• Optical fiber ports
• Fiber management tray
• One or two Power Supplies or one Power Supply +
Optional Buoy Power Backup module
1 RF Port 1 Base contains six 5/8-24 RF ports, P1, P2, P3, P4.
2 Powering Port 5 The node ships with ports 5 and 6 blocked by a plugs which
can be removed to allow the insertion of a dedicated power
stinger. The power adapter cable kit screws into the node
insert.
3 Powering Port 5 AC
board
The AC board receives the AC power feed from the dedicated
powering port, via the power adapter kit. There is an
equivalent AC board at port 6.
4 AC Cable For connecting AC power between the base and lid.
5 HD-AFI connectors
and cables
HD-AFI cables connect Pebble-2 modules to the Ripple-2 RF
tray.
6 Pebble-2 module
Available Pebble-2 RPD/RMP models:
• Pebble-2 RPD, with 2xSFPs, supporting DS/US
configurations:
◦ 2x4
◦ 2x2
◦ 1x2
• Pebble-2 RMP, with 2xSFPs, supporting DS/US
configurations:
◦ 2x4
◦ 2x2
◦ 1x2
• Pebble-2-ESD (RMD)
7 SFP Optical
transceiver ports
Two optical ports can be populated with optical transceivers in
SFP+ compliant packages for connection to fiber cables.
8 Power supply One or two power supplies, delivered with power cables
supplied by Harmonic.
9 Optical fiber port Two optical fiber ports are available.
